Background
Founded in 2014, Mirai Sozo Investments has dedicated itself to supporting seed and early-stage startups spun out from academia, particularly focusing on technological innovations stemming from universities. The firm is well-regarded for its hands-on support, guiding startups from research and development phases through to successful funding and realization of technology into society.
To date, Mirai Sozo has successfully launched two funds, the Mirai Sozo 1st Fund (totaling 3.34 billion yen) and the 2nd Fund (totaling 4.25 billion yen). This track record includes the notable public listings (IPOs) of companies such as Synspective, QD Laser, Kiyo Learning, and Tsukuruba. The firm has also been active in investing in startups focused on GX-related themes such as next-generation solar cells, unused heat power generation, and green ammonia, thereby supporting innovations in both domestic and international markets.
Mirai Sozo 3rd Fund Overview
The Mirai Sozo 3rd Fund aims to raise a target of 6 billion yen, with a maximum cap of 8 billion yen. By the first closing, the fund has already reached an impressive scale of 80%.
Key Details
- - Fund Name: Mirai Sozo 3rd Investment Limited Partnership
- - Establishment Date: December 1, 2025
- - Fund Size: Target of 6 billion yen (up to 8 billion yen maximum)
- - Duration: 10 years (with an option for a maximum extension of 3 years)
Investment Focus
The fund will focus on:
- - Startups related to Science Tokyo and other national universities.
- - Profitable and promising technology-based ventures in various advanced tech domains.
Main Investment Areas
- - Green Transformation (Carbon neutrality, next-gen energy, energy-saving technologies, greenhouse gas capture, and storage, etc.)
- - Life Sciences (Medical devices, drug development, healthcare, etc.)
- - Other Advanced Technology Areas (Space, semiconductors, robotics, etc.)
Key Investment Stages
- - Lead investments in venture creation projects.
- - Seed and early-stage investments with a focus on lead and follow-up investments.
- - Continuous follow-on investments in lead projects.
Limited Partners
The incorporation of several significant financial institutions represents a strong backing for the 3rd Fund, including:
- - Tokyo Metropolitan Government
- - Seibu Shinkin Bank
- - Chuo Shinkin Bank
- - Tama Shinkin Bank
- - Hanno Shinkin Bank
- - Joyou Bank, among others.
The Dream Team
The fund's management team comprises key figures with deep expertise in technology and finance. The General Partner is Yuuki Okada, President and CEO, alongside Daisuke Kaneko, who has significant IPO experience from the previous two funds. Ryohhei Takahashi, an executive officer with a background in founding university-based ventures, joins them to complete a powerhouse team dedicated to fostering the growth of deep tech startups.
The Unique Proposition of Mirai Sozo 3rd Fund
- - Venture Creation Until IPO: The fund prides itself on maintaining a consistent support system, nurturing ventures from before inception through to the IPO phase. By leveraging governmental support programs, Mirai Sozo integrates technical verification alongside customer development, business model construction, and team formation.
- - National University Network: By creating strong connections between regional industries and promising technological seeds, the 3rd Fund not only produces startups but also aims to revitalize the local industrial landscape through innovative projects. The fund plans to act as a growth hub that brings together various stakeholders, thus enhancing the overall startup ecosystem.
